"Crna mačka, beli mačor" is a Serbian romantic black comedy crime film, often described as a "screwball comedy," directed by the legendary, two-time Cannes Palme d'Or winner, Emir Kusturica. Shot by (who also shot The Fifth Element and Leon: The Professional ). The colors are saturated: yellows, ochres, muddy browns, bright blues.
